Did a search and couldn't find the answer.  I'm thinking of putting a 3rd generation Tri-Power on a Colt 6920 with the higher FSB.  Will it co-witness with the factory mount or just be in the field of view.  If not what mount will I need to buy?  If not possible to co-witness will I need a riser to get the front sight out of the FOV?

Any standard mount will be fine. If you zero the tripower correctly, you will use the inside and outside of the chevron for man size targets at different ranges. Also works like a red dot as a CCO. Zero as instructed in the manual.
